Anchor System and Relayer System

Q: Can you explain the role of the Anchor System and the Relayer System in the Webb Protocol?

A: The Anchor System connects merkle trees on different blockchains, ensuring liveness and safety. The Relayer System acts as an oracle, data relayer, and protocol governance participant, relaying information for connected Anchors and enhancing the overall security of the system.

Q: How does the Anchor System work, and what is its significance in the Webb Protocol?

A: The Anchor System connects merkle trees on different blockchains using a graph-like framework, allowing anchors to maintain the latest state of their neighboring anchors. This interconnectedness enables users to prove the existence of data in any anchor from any anchor, satisfying the properties of liveness and safety.

Q: What role do relayers play in the Webb Protocol, and how do they contribute to the overall security of the system?

A: Relayers in the Webb Protocol serve as multi-faceted oracles, data relayers, and protocol governance participants. They relay information for a connected set of anchors on a bridge, updating each anchor's state and allowing applications to reference data stored across connected anchors. By fulfilling their roles, relayers enhance the overall security of the system.

Q: Can you explain the Distributed Key Generation (DKG) protocol and its significance in ensuring the safety and liveness of the Anchor System?

A: The DKG protocol governs the Anchor System by acting as a security tool. Trust is placed in the DKG to sign the data it is meant to sign, ensuring bridge updates are valid. The protocol guarantees the safety and liveness of the Anchor System, maintaining its ability to be updated in a partially-synchronous environment while ensuring all updates are valid.

Q: What advantages does Hubble Bridge offer for users?

A: Hubble Bridge offers an easy-to-use interface for privately moving assets cross-chain, leveraging Webb's Shielded Asset Protocol for secure and private transactions. This allows users to maintain privacy while transferring assets between blockchains efficiently.
